CM announces Rs 15 lakh incentive for Odia Olympic athletes

Bhubaneswar, July 8: In an inspiring move to support athletes, Chief Minister Mohan Charan Majhi announced on Monday an incentive of Rs. 15 lakh each for two athletes from Odisha who will represent India in the upcoming Paris Olympics.
CM Majhi extended his support to Javelin thrower Kishore Kumar Jena and Hockey player Amit Rohidas, who are set to compete in Paris from July 26 to August 11, 2024.
Majhi expressed his hopes, saying, “I believe this amount will motivate the athletes to deliver outstanding performances and bring glory to the nation.”
He added, “The Olympics are the pinnacle of sports. By qualifying for the Paris Olympics, Kishore Jena and Amit Rohidas have made not only their homeland but the entire state proud with their achievement.”
Extending his heartfelt greetings, the CM said, “On behalf of the people of Odisha, I extend my best wishes and congratulations to both young athletes. I have full faith in their indomitable willpower, hard work, dedication, and perseverance, which will inspire the budding talents of the state.”
The people of Odisha have complete confidence in both individuals. With the blessings of Lord Jagannath, the Chief Minister expressed hope that they will bring honor to the state and the country through their exceptional sports skills at the Olympics.
